MG-ADL stands for Myasthenia Gravis Activities of Daily Living.

It is a short patient-reported questionnaire used to measure how much myasthenia gravis (MG) is affecting everyday function. It asks about symptoms such as:

  • talking
  • chewing
  • swallowing
  • breathing
  • brushing hair or teeth
  • getting up from a chair
  • double vision
  • eyelid droop

Each item is scored from 0 to 3, so the total score ranges from 0 to 24.

  • Lower score = fewer symptoms / less impact
  • Higher score = more severe impact on daily life

Doctors and researchers use it to:

  • track symptom severity over time
  • see whether treatment is helping
  • compare disease burden between visits

It is a screening and monitoring tool, not a diagnosis by itself.
